@import url(https://fonts.googleapis.com/css2?family=Rubik:ital,wght@0,300;0,400;0,500;0,600;0,700;0,800;0,900;1,300;1,400;1,500;1,600;1,700;1,800;1,900&display=swap);.svg-icon[data-v-554b6bc9]{fill:#fff}.pop[data-v-e559b704]{z-index:999}.date[data-v-e559b704] .dp__input{width:100%;height:40px;background-color:transparent;border:none}.input[data-v-e559b704]:focus-within{border:1px solid #3521b5!important}.input[data-v-e559b704]:hover{border:1px solid #b7e2f8!important}.error[data-v-e559b704]{border:1px solid #ea9f9f!important}.error input[data-v-e559b704]{color:#ea3636!important}.succe[data-v-e559b704]{border:1px solid #5fc187!important}@media screen and (max-width:769px)and (min-width:701px){.input[data-v-e559b704]{height:65px;font-size:18px}}@media screen and (max-width:700px){.input[data-v-e559b704]{height:55px;font-size:14px}}.svg-icon[data-v-75ead8a6]{fill:#fff}.bloc[data-v-75ead8a6]{filter:drop-shadow(0 4.08108px 10px rgba(0,0,0,.1));z-index:1}.success[data-v-712f76a2]{z-index:999}.cardinal[data-v-712f76a2]{width:42%}.success-container[data-v-712f76a2]{font-family:Rubik,sans-serif;width:100%;background-color:#f5f5f5;height:auto;margin:auto;border-radius:12px}.diviser[data-v-712f76a2]{height:1px;background-color:#ddd}.inputo[data-v-712f76a2]{border:.5px solid #dcdce4;box-sizing:border-box;border-radius:4px}input[data-v-712f76a2]{background-color:transparent}@media screen and (max-width:700px){.success-container[data-v-712f76a2]{width:100%;height:100vh}.titre[data-v-712f76a2]{font-size:18px}.bloc1[data-v-712f76a2]{width:100%}.bloc2[data-v-712f76a2]{width:100%;font-size:18px}.button[data-v-712f76a2]{width:100%;font-size:16px}.cardinal[data-v-712f76a2]{width:100%}}@media screen and (max-width:1024px)and (min-width:770px){.cardinal[data-v-712f76a2]{width:65%}.titre[data-v-712f76a2]{font-size:18px}.button[data-v-712f76a2]{width:100%;height:55px;font-size:19px}}@media screen and (max-width:769px)and (min-width:701px){.cardinal[data-v-712f76a2]{width:90%}.titre[data-v-712f76a2]{font-size:18px}.button[data-v-712f76a2]{width:100%;height:55px;font-size:19px}}@media screen and (max-width:320px){.cardinal[data-v-712f76a2]{width:100%}.titre[data-v-712f76a2]{font-size:14px}.button[data-v-712f76a2]{width:100%;height:55px;font-size:15px}}